Defining Tier 2 Audiences and Their Core Dynamics
Tier 2 audiences occupy a paradoxical space: too early for high-intent retention tactics, yet too valuable to treat as passive. Defined by intermediate engagement—frequent but not yet committed—these users exhibit distinct behavioral signatures such as partial consideration, episodic interaction, and shifting intent signals. Unlike Tier 1’s broad segmentation based on demographics or broad intent, Tier 2 requires continuous behavioral inference to maintain relevance. Key dynamics include rapid context shifts, sensitivity to timing and placement, and a need for micro-moments of connection that bridge awareness and consideration.
Behavioral Signatures and Real-Time Adaptation Needs
Tier 2 users display nuanced behavioral patterns requiring real-time adaptation. For instance, a user browsing financial comparison tools may pause at loan calculators but abandon if content feels generic. Their micro-signals—scroll depth, hover duration, click hesitation—reveal intent volatility. Success demands dynamic content that evolves within seconds: adjusting tone, highlighting risk-reward tradeoffs, or injecting urgency only when engagement thresholds dip. Implementation frameworks must incorporate event-triggered personalization rules—such as displaying a micro-announcement when a user lingers past 30 seconds on a FAQ page—ensuring content remains contextually pulsing rather than static.
The Critical Role of Contextual Relevance
Contextual relevance transforms micro-engagement from noise into connection. Tier 2 audiences respond not to generic personalization but to situational cues: device type, geographic location, time of day, and prior interaction patterns. For example, a fintech app serving Tier 2 users might serve a micro-announcement about mobile check deposits only during evening commutes when usage data indicates high intent. This requires layered context engines that merge behavioral signals with environmental data—enabling content to adapt from “general offer” to “personal next step” in real time.

The Science Behind Micro-Interactions
Micro-engagements exploit fundamental cognitive mechanisms: the Zeigarnik effect—where incomplete tasks increase mental persistence—drives users to return to unresolved questions; dopamine spikes from rapid, low-effort rewards reinforce continued interaction; and attention residue—the lingering focus after brief interactions—enables subtle content nudges to persist mentally. Research shows micro-messages delivered within 3 seconds of behavioral cues boost retention by 42% compared to delayed responses. For Tier 2 audiences, this means precision timing often outweighs message content in engagement impact.

Common Pitfalls and Advanced Mitigation Strategies
Even precision micro-engagement risks failure when misapplied. Below are critical pitfalls with actionable fixes:
- Over-Micro-Engagement: Bombarding users with excessive micro-messages triggers annoyance and unsubscribes.
*Fix*: Apply a engagement cap—limit micro-tactics to 2–3 per session, based on real-time fatigue indicators like scroll speed drops or repeated skips. - Data Overload and Paralysis: Over-reliance on real-time signals without clear decision logic causes inconsistent delivery.
*Fix*: Build a tiered signal hierarchy—prioritize high-impact, low-complexity triggers (e.g., scroll depth) over noisy, low-signal data (e.g., mouse movement). - Misaligned Intent Signaling: Tactics triggered by intent signals that don’t match actual user goals erode trust.
*Fix*: Implement intent validation layers—cross-check micro-triggers with behavioral sequences (e.g., “paused + scrolled + clicked” before sending a follow-up message). - Case Study: A Brand’s Mid-Flight Misstep
“A travel brand’s micro-announcement campaign flooded Tier 2 users with flash sales every 15 seconds during booking flows. Despite high initial clicks, completion rates dropped 29% due to cognitive overload. Recovery required reducing frequency, segmenting by session depth, and adding pause-based opt-outs.”
Advanced Execution: Synchronizing Micro-Tactics Across Ecosystems
True mastery lies in integrating micro-engagement across platforms while maintaining contextual coherence. This requires:
- Cross-Channel Synchronization
- Deploy identical micro-triggers across web, mobile, and SMS, but adapt format per platform—e.g., push notifications for urgency, in-app banners for continuity. Use real-time data pipelines to feed behavioral signals (scroll, dwell, skip) into unified engagement engines.
- Real-Time Data Pipelines
- Implement low-latency ingestion of micro-signals (via event streaming tools like Kafka or Firebase) to enable sub-second content adaptation. Pair with edge computing to reduce latency in mobile and regional content delivery.
